Choosing The Right Colours
The yellow was a perfect to the grey of the ground and the murky look of the puddles. I wanted a vibrant yellow for this painting because the reflections off the puddle would be very colourful and vibrant. Rían had great fun playing with the rubber ducks in the rain and puddles. I used three yellows from Winsor and Newton. The gray is Gamblin Portland gray a beautiful warm neutral that I use a lot. Chrome yellow, cadmium yellow and yellow ochre.
